SSL, which is short for Secure Sockets Layer, is a security protocol which encrypts the information which customers submit on a website. If they type in a username and a password on a login page or they acquire services and products online and they input their credit card info, the data will be exchanged with the hosting server in an encrypted form, consequently an unauthorized third-party won't be able to see it.
